Why serial number traceability matters on the Twista Pro
Batch identifiers should appear on the unit, the inner tray and the master carton.
In practice the decision comes down to three numbers: unit cost, freight per unit and the realistic sell through rate for Twista Pro.
A simple spreadsheet linking batch to destination account is usually sufficient at this scale.

Checklist
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.

Frequently asked questions
Why does batch traceability matter for Twista Pro?
It limits the scope of any future quality action to the affected batch instead of the whole range.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
Do you support long term supply agreements?
Yes, rolling agreements with defined review points work better for both sides than rigid annual commitments.
